ORDINANCE NO. 9505
AN ORDINANCE AMENDING ZONING ORDINANCE NO. 7084 AND THE OFFICIAL MAP
OF THE CITY OF LUBBOCK MAKING THE FOLLOWING CHANGES: ZONE CASE NO. 1642-P; A
ZONING CHANGE FROM C-2 TO C-4 SPECIFIC USE PERMIT FOR A DRIVE-IN RESTAURANT
AND ALL UNCONDITIONALLY PERMITTED C-2 USES ON THE SOUTH 100 FEET OF LOT 2-A-
1-A, BLOCK 2, FURR WOLF ADDITION, LUBBOCK, TEXAS; PROVIDING A PENALTY;
PROVIDING A SAVINGS CLAUSE AND PROVIDING FOR PUBLICATION.
WHEREAS, the proposed changes in zoning as hereinafter made have been
duly presented to the Planning and Zoning Commission for its recommendation
which was received by the City Council and, after due consideration, the City
Council finds that due to changed conditions, it would be expedient and in the
interest of the public health, safety and general welfare to make those pro-
posed changes in zoning; and
WHEREAS, all conditions precedent required by law for a valid amendment
to the Zoning Ordinance and Map have been fully complied with, including giv-
ing notices in compliance with Section 29-29 of the Code of Ordinances, City
of Lubbock, Texas, and the notices provided by the Texas Local Government Code
§211.007 (Vernon, 1990), and notice was duly published in the Lubbock
Avalanche-Journal more than fifteen (15) days prior to the date of the public
hearing before the City Council on the proposed amendment, and the public
hearing according to said notice, was duly held in the City Council Chamber of
the Municipal Building, Lubbock, Texas, at which time persons appeared in
support of the proposal; and, after said hearing, it was determined by the
City Council that it would be in the public interest, due to changed condi-
tions, that the Zoning Ordinance and the Zoning Map be amended in the manner
hereinafter set forth in the body of this Ordinance and this Ordinance having
been introduced prior to first reading hereof; NOW THEREFORE:
B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F LUBBOCK:
ZONE CASE NO. 1642-P
SECTION 1. THAT Ordinance No. 7084 and the Official Zoning Map are
amended as follows:
A change of zoning from C-2 to C-4 Specific Use Permit, under pro-
visions of Section 29-24(c)(24) of the Code of Ordinances of the
City of Lubbock for a drive-in restaurant and all unconditionally
permitted C-2 uses on the South 100 feet of Lot 2-A-1-A, Block 2,
Furr Wolf Addition, City of Lubbock, Lubbock County, Texas, lo-
cated at the West side of 7100 Quaker Avenue.
SECTION 2. THAT the Codes Administrator of the City of Lubbock is
authorized to issue a Specific Use Permit to the Applicant in said Zone Case
in accordance with the conditions imposed by the City Council, provided said
applicant agrees to be bound by the terms of the Specific Use Permit, the
granting of which is hereby made subject to compliance to all provisions of
Zoning Ordinance No. 7084, as amended, including particularly, but not limited
to, Section 29-24 of the Codified Zoning Ordinance, which provides that a
Specific Use Permit and a Building Permit shall be applied for and secured
within thirty (30) months of the effective date of the zone change or all
undeveloped property shall automatically revert back to the previous zoning
classification, which in this case is the C-2 zone district; and if such re-
version occurs, the Codes Administrator is directed to remove from the Zoning
Map the legend indicating such specific use. The Specific Use authorized by
this Ordinance is permitted under provision of Section 29-24(c)(24) of Codi-
fied Zoning Ordinance No. 7084 on the property described as the South 100 feet
of Lot 2-A-1-A, Block 2, Furr Wolf Addition, City of Lubbock, Lubbock County,
Texas.
SECTION 3. THAT violation of any provisions of this Ordinance shall
be deemed a misdemeanor punishable by a fine not to exceed One Thousand and
No/100 Dollars ($1,000.00) as provided in Section 29-31 of the Zoning Ordi-
nance of the City of Lubbock.
SECTION 4. THAT should any paragraph, sentence, clause, phrase or word
of this Ordinance be declared unconstitutional or invalid for any reason, the
remainder of this Ordinance shall not be affected thereby.
SECTION 5. THAT the City Secretary is hereby authorized to cause pub-
lication of the descriptive caption of this Ordinance as an alternative method
provided by law.
AND IT IS SO ORDERED.
